RAD -Chronic lower airway disease and hypovolemia in a 16 year old FS DLH cat with chronic renal failure and IMHA

This 16 year old FS DLH cat has a history of chronic renal failure and recently IMHA.  Physical exam: very thin, slightly jaundiced, quiet. PVC 24%, TP 5.8g/dl. Received tranfusion.

Post-hepatic obstruction in a 7-year-old FS Shih Tzu mixed breed

A 7-year-old FS Shih Tzu mixed breed was presented for a second opinion. Oreo was grossly jaundiced and had been treated for sometime for Immune Mediated Thrombocytopenia. CBC found WBC: 25,700, Diff: neutrophilia with some bands noted. Monocytosis. HCT: 44.3% and Platelets were normal at 307,000. Blood chemistry revealed glucose 165, globulin 4.8, ALKP 6764,…

Thoracic mass suggestive for lung neoplasia in a 6 year old MI Rhodesian Ridgeback dog

A 6 year-old male Rhodesian Ridgeback with a history of IMHA and current cortisone therapy was presented for being depressed. Abnormalities on physical examination were pale pink mucosa, tachycardia, polypnea, and a distended abdomen. CBC showed leukocytosis, neutrophilia, monocytosis, and regenerative anemia. Coombs test was negative.
